Support staff frequently see tickets about Ledgerpine's spreadsheet export consuming excessive memory. Large workbooks are streamed row-by-row since version 3.2, but the streaming path is only active when the export worker can authenticate with the chunking service; otherwise it falls back to in-memory generation, which is what triggers the out-of-memory crashes. When reproducing a ticket locally, enable streaming by adding the following line to your worker's .env file.

env line for kageg-fajof: COURIER_KEY5=93d14

Subject: Flaglet rollout framework — cut-over wrap-up

Hi support crew,

We flipped everything over to Flaglet last night, so all feature flags now live in one place instead of three dashboards nobody trusted. Old flags were migrated automatically; anything stale got archived rather than deleted, so don't panic if a customer mentions a flag you can't find. Percentage rollouts now evaluate server-side, which fixes the sticky-bucket complaints. If you need to sanity-check behavior, the evaluator runs with the settings below.

config for kafof-bawef:
holath:
  log_level: debug
  metrics_host: metrics.holath.qorvelsys.internal
  pin: 2191
  pool_size: 32

Ticket CAT-88: Catalog cache invalidation broken in staging

Hey, quick one for review. The Shopwren product catalog isn't invalidating cached entries after price updates — turns out staging was pointed at the old Fernmarket cache cluster, so purge events go nowhere. I've repointed `CACHE_CLUSTER_URL` and bumped `INVALIDATION_TTL` down to 60s to match prod. One more thing before this merges: the purge endpoint now requires authentication, and the env file was missing that entry entirely. It should sit right after this sentence in the file.

env line for bawif-kadup: ARCHIVE_KEY3=584